Our Founder
Suetables began in 2005 as a passion project by founder + CEO Sue Henderson, a stay-at-home mom looking for a creative and meaningful outlet. What started as hand-stamping words onto vintage spoons for baby gifts soon evolved into something more personal—etching her sons' initials onto pendants to keep them close to her heart.
As friends began requesting their own personalized pieces, the vision grew. From simple hand-stamped charms to a full jewelry line, Suetables was built on the idea of using words and symbols to tell stories and express personal truths.
Today, Suetables has grown from a home-based business into a thriving retail brand with multiple storefronts and a global e-commerce presence.
Suetables have been worn by icons like Meghan Sussex and are featured in FASHION, Marie Claire, Harper's Bazaar and People Magazine.
While the brand has expanded, our mission remains the same: to create jewelry that helps people share their stories and carry meaning in a beautiful, wearable form.
